Player Review
86 - Rulebreakers
I've used quite a few strikers in my squad, with all sorts of characteristics and ratings, but the one constant certainty is Marko. I bought him on the market for almost nothing but since then I played so many games and scored so many goals with him (and still do) that I just wouldn't bench him even for several strikers with better stats. This guy can do it all:
- his pace is more than enough to get past defenders, especially with the hunter chem style. Great with through balls
- his shooting is amazing, you can easily bag tons of power shots from different angles with both feet
- dribbling-wise he's not Ronaldinho, but he's agile and usually keeps the ball close. Defo not clunky, he's in control also when he's sprinting
- physically dominant, he scores lots of headers and opponents bounce off his shoulders on ground duels. Coupled with his dribbling, this also allows him to receive the ball facing away from the goal, protect it and turn to shoot
Bonus: ACROBATIC GOALS. Loads of them. Bicycle kicks directly from corners, scorpion kicks, volleys, backheels, I don't know why but he triggers those animations a lot more often than others. And you'll just love that.
Great as a lone striker or paired with a dribbler.
